/* CSS Document */

.qfuwulingyu{ border-bottom:1px solid #ccc; border-top:1px solid #ccc; overflow:hidden;}
.qfuwulingyu li{ border-bottom:1px solid #ccc;    padding: 25px 0px 25px 0px;}
.qfuwulingyu li span{ display:block; float:left;  width:19%; height:90px;}
.icon1{ background:url(../img/icon1.jpg) no-repeat center center;   }
.icon2{ background:url(../img/icon2.jpg) no-repeat center center ;}
.icon3{ background:url(../img/icon3.jpg) no-repeat center center;}
.icon4{ background:url(../img/icon4.jpg) no-repeat center center;}
.icon5{ background:url(../img/icon5.jpg) no-repeat center center; }





.qfuwulingyu .q_box{ overflow:hidden;}
.qfuwulingyu li .txt_box{ float:right; width:80%;}
.qfuwulingyu li .txt_box h1{ font-weight:normal; font-size:10.5pt; color:#3e3a39; margin-bottom:5px;margin-left:5px; }
.qfuwulingyu li .txt_box p{ font-size:9pt; color:#595757; line-height:20px; margin-left:5px; }
.btndetail{ display:inline-block; width:100px; height:30px; line-height:30px; text-align:center; font-size:12px; border-radius:5px; border:1px solid #ea5514; color:#ea5514; margin-left:84%;}
.yewu_box{ overflow:hidden;border-top: 1px solid #ccc; border-bottom: 1px solid #ccc;}
.yewu_box h1{ color:#004fa2; font-weight:normal; font-size:10.5pt; height:50px; line-height:50px; }
.bg1{ background:url(../img/yewubg1.png) no-repeat right center;}
.bg2{ background:url(../img/yewubg2.png) no-repeat right center;}
.bg3{ background:url(../img/yewubg3.png) no-repeat right center;}
.bg4{ background:url(../img/yewubg4.png) no-repeat right center;}
.bg5{ background:url(../img/yewubg5.png) no-repeat right center;}


.q_left{ float:left; }
/*.q_left li{ border-right:1px solid #898989;}*/
.yewu_box li { 
padding: 10px 10px; 
border-bottom: 1px solid #ccc; 
float: left; 
width: 43%; 
}
.yewu_box p{ color:#595757; font-size:9pt; height:80px;}

.q_right{ float:right; width:50%;}
.clearfix{ clear:both;}
@media screen and (max-width: 720px) {
	.qfuwulingyu li span{ display:block; width:25%;}
	.qfuwulingyu li .txt_box{  width:75%; }
    .btndetail {
		width:60px; height:25px; line-height:25px;
        margin-left:76%;
    }
.icon1{ background:url(../img/icon1.jpg) no-repeat center center; background-size:80% 80%; }
.icon2{ background:url(../img/icon2.jpg) no-repeat center center; background-size:80% 80%;}
.icon3{ background:url(../img/icon3.jpg) no-repeat center center; background-size:80% 80%;}
.icon4{ background:url(../img/icon4.jpg) no-repeat center center ; background-size:80% 80%;}
.icon5{ background:url(../img/icon5.jpg) no-repeat center center; background-size:80% 80%;}
.bg1{ background:url(../img/yewubg1.png) no-repeat right 10px; background-size:25% 60%;}
.bg2{ background:url(../img/yewubg2.png) no-repeat right 10px; background-size:25% 60%;}
.bg3{ background:url(../img/yewubg3.png) no-repeat right 10px; background-size:25% 60%;}
.bg4{ background:url(../img/yewubg4.png) no-repeat right 10px; background-size:25% 60%;}
.bg5{ background:url(../img/yewubg5.png) no-repeat right 10px; background-size:25% 60%;}
}
.huibox{ width:100%; height:20px; background:#f6f5fa;}







 .caseList .item .top .txt p {
      padding-left: 12px;
      width: 70%;
      overflow: hidden;
      height: 14px;
      line-height: 14px;
      }
      
      .caseList .item .top .txt .more {
      background: url(../img/iconAdd.png) no-repeat left center;
      width: 75px;
      height: 35px;
      position: absolute;
      right: 0;
      bottom: 0;
      background-size: 70px auto;
      }
      
      .caseList .item .top .txt .more.on {
      background: url(../img/iconMinus.png) no-repeat left center;
      background-size: 70px auto;
      }
      
      .caseList .label {
      color: #999;
      height: 22px;
      line-height: 22px;
      padding: 12px 0 20px 10px;
      border: 1px #fff solid;
      border-width: 0 1px;
      }
      
      .caseList .label.on {
      border-color: #e4e4e4;
      }
      
      .caseList .label span {
      padding: 4px 10px;
      border: 1px #ccc solid;
      border-radius: 5px;
      margin-right: 10px;
      }
      
      .caseList .bt .cont:nth-child(odd) {
      background-color: #f0f0f0;
      }
      
      .biaoqian {
      color: #727171;
      padding: 20px 0px 15px 10px;
      border: 1px solid #ccc;
      }
      
      .biaoqian span {
      border: 1px solid #ccc;
      border-radius: 5px;
      padding: 3px;
      margin-right: 10px;
      }
      
      .grayBack {
      background: #fff;
      }
      
      .huibox {
      width: 100%;
      height: 20px;
      background: #f6f5fa;
      }
      
      .question li p {
      background: url(../img/iconLi.png) no-repeat 0 0px;
      padding-left: 42px;
      }
      
      .answer li p {
      background: url(../img/iconLi2.png) no-repeat 0 0px;
      padding-left: 42px;
      }
      
      .caseList .item .top .txt {
      height: 11px;
      line-height: 11px;
      font-size: 11px;
      }
      
      .jiaju {
      overflow: hidden;
      padding-bottom: 15px;
      }
      
      .jiaju i {
      width: 19%;
      height: 130px;
      float: left;
      /*background: url(../img/jiajuicon.jpg) no-repeat center center;*/
      }
      
      .jiaju dl {
      width: 80%;
      float: right;
      }
      
      .jiaju dl dt {
      font-size: 14px;
      color: #3e3a39;
      line-height: 20px;
      }
      
      .jiaju dl dd {
      font-size: 9pt;
      color: #595757;
      line-height: 20px;
      }
      
      @media screen and (max-width: 720px) {
      .jiaju i {
      width: 25%;
      float: left;
      background: url(../img/jiajuicon.jpg) no-repeat center center;
      background-size: 70% 40%;
      }
        .question li p {
            background: url(../img/iconLi.png) no-repeat 0 3px;
            padding-left: 40px;
            background-size: 29px 20px;
        }

        .answer li p {
            background: url(../img/iconLi2.png) no-repeat 0 3px;
            padding-left: 40px;
            background-size: 29px 20px;
        }
      .jiaju dl {
      width: 75%;
      float: right;
      }
      }
        .aboutMenu {
            height: 145px;
        }
            .aboutMenu dt {
                padding: 33px 13px 0 11px;
                background: #ea5514 url(../img/iconAboutMenu.png) no-repeat 12px 97px;
                background-size: 10px 10px;
            }

            .aboutMenu dd a i {
                height: 26px;
                margin: 5px 0 0px;
            }
      
      .aboutMenu dd p {
      border-left: 1px solid #ccc;
      padding-left: 6px;
      }
      
      .list ul li {
      margin-left: 10px;
      }
      
      .question li {
      border-top: 1px #ccc solid;
      }
        .aboutMenu dd a {
            width: 38px;
        }

        .aboutMenu dd {
            padding: 0 10px;
        }